[0031] In one embodiment, a method for rapid damage detection of a composite material plate is provided, the method comprising the steps of:
[0032] S100, performing a modal test on the composite material plate, obtaining modal vibration data, and then obtaining a modal vibration surface;
[0033] S200. Calculating the two-dimensional generalized local entropy of the mode shape data points on the mode shape surface;
[0034] S300, judging whether there is abnormal data in the two-dimensional generalized local entropy;
[0035] S400. If there is abnormal data in S300, it is determined that the composite material plate is damaged; otherwise, it is determined that the composite material plate is healthy;
